Sub: People are programmed to be fat, long before they are born.
A high fat diet even before you were born might have programmed you to a life of over-eating. A new research suggests that eating a high-fat diet in pregnancy may cause changes in the fetal brain that lead to obesity early in life.
Tests on rats showed those born to mothers fed a high-fat diet had many more brain cells specialized to produce appetite-stimulating proteins.
Even before the birth, the high-fat pups had a much larger number of brain cells that produce orexigenicpeptides –and they kept them throughout their lives. Their mother’s high-fat appeared to stimulate production of cells, and their subsequent migration to parts of the brain linked to obesity.
